Tondli (Burj), Mouda

Tondli (Burj) (तोंडली(बु)) is a village located in the Mauda Taluka of Nagpur district of Maharashtra. The village falls in Mouda block and comes under Tondli Village Panchayat. It belongs to Ramtek parliament constituency and Kamthi assembly constituency.

As on May 2024, the current population of Tondli (Burj) is 663 out of which 353 are males and rest 310 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 878 females per 1000 males. There are around 47 teenagers in Tondli (Burj). It has literacy rate of 75% which means around 495 persons can read and write. Total 23 people belonging to scheduled caste and 0 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 159 households in Tondli (Burj), which means every family has 4 members on average. The village has working population of 401. The pincode of Tondli (Burj) is 441106 and there are many postoffices around the village which can used to send speed post, registered parcel etc.
